Saturday President Christensen came to interview Bujagali for baptism and other issues involving polygamy. He proved himself to have a change of heart and prepare to enter into baptismal covenants. His baptism yesterday was awesome! His friend, Lucas, who referred him to us was the one to baptize him. They were both very happy. Just before he was baptized he was asked to stand in the front so everyone could see him. He stood up and looked back to the crowd of people and said with a fist pound to the air, "Praise the Lord" and then sat down. I was sitting next to him and I almost started to laugh. It was just a cool moment.
